Skip to content

Commit d7f8169

Browse files
committed
fix : docker directory
1 parent b4c0c63 commit d7f8169

6 files changed

+18
-14
lines changed

server/Makefile

+10-6
Original file line numberDiff line numberDiff line change
@@ -13,11 +13,12 @@ ENV_SAMPLE = $(shell cat $(ENV_SAMPLE_FILE))
1313
GO := go run
1414

1515
# docker
16-
DOCKER_FILE_DIR := ./docker
17-
DOCKER_COMPOSE_CI := $(DOCKER_FILE_DIR)/docker-compose.ci.yml
16+
DOCKER_FILE_DIR := ./docker/dev
17+
DOCKER_FILE_CI_DIR := ./docker/ci
18+
DOCKER_COMPOSE_CI := $(DOCKER_FILE_CI_DIR)/docker-compose.ci.yml
1819
DOCKER_COMPOSE_LOCAL := $(DOCKER_FILE_DIR)/docker-compose.local.yml
1920
DOCKER_COMPOSE_LOCAL_DATABASE := $(DOCKER_FILE_DIR)/docker-compose.local.database.yml
20-
DOCKER_COMPOSE_CI_DATABASE := $(DOCKER_FILE_DIR)/docker-compose.ci.database.yml
21+
DOCKER_COMPOSE_CI_DATABASE := $(DOCKER_FILE_CI_DIR)/docker-compose.ci.database.yml
2122
DOCKER_COMPOSE_LOCAL_SERVER := $(DOCKER_FILE_DIR)/docker-compose.local.server.yml
2223
DOCKER_EXEC := docker exec -it
2324
GITHUB_REPOSITORY_NAME := glyph
@@ -34,7 +35,7 @@ up: ## docker環境を立ち上げる
3435
$(ENV_LOCAL) docker-compose \
3536
-f $(DOCKER_COMPOSE_LOCAL) \
3637
-f $(DOCKER_COMPOSE_LOCAL_DATABASE) \
37-
-f $(DOCKER_COMPOSE_LOCAL_SERVER) up
38+
-f $(DOCKER_COMPOSE_LOCAL_SERVER) up -d
3839

3940
.PHONY: down
4041
down: ## dockerイメージを削除し、docker環境を閉じる
@@ -48,7 +49,7 @@ down: ## dockerイメージを削除し、docker環境を閉じる
4849
fclean:down del-volumes ## マウントしたデータを削除、またdockerイメージも削除する
4950

5051
.PHONY: re
51-
re:fclean up ## 完全に初期化した状態でdocker環境を立ち上げる
52+
re:fclean up sleep migrate## 完全に初期化した状態でdocker環境を立ち上げる
5253

5354
.PHONY: run-db
5455
run-db:
@@ -84,4 +85,7 @@ deploy:
8485
.PHONY: help
8586
help: ## コマンドの一覧を標示する
8687
@grep -E '^[a-zA-Z_-]+:.*?## .*$$' $(MAKEFILE_LIST) | \
87-
awk 'BEGIN {FS = ":.*?## "}; {printf "\033[36m%-20s\033[0m %s\n", $$1, $$2}'
88+
awk 'BEGIN {FS = ":.*?## "}; {printf "\033[36m%-20s\033[0m %s\n", $$1, $$2}'
89+
90+
sleep:
91+
sleep 30

server/docker/docker-compose.ci.database.yml server/docker/ci/docker-compose.ci.database.yml

+3-3
Original file line numberDiff line numberDiff line change
@@ -3,12 +3,12 @@ version: "3"
33
services:
44
database:
55
build:
6-
context: ../database
6+
context: ../../database
77
dockerfile: Dockerfile
88
volumes:
99
- glyph-data:/var/lib/mysql
10-
- ../database/mysql/conf/my.cnf:/etc/mysql/conf.d/my.cnf
11-
- ../database/mysql/sql:/docker-entrypoint-initdb.d
10+
- ../../database/mysql/conf/my.cnf:/etc/mysql/conf.d/my.cnf
11+
- ../../database/mysql/sql:/docker-entrypoint-initdb.d
1212
ports:
1313
- 3306:3306
1414
environment:
File renamed without changes.

server/docker/docker-compose.local.database.yml server/docker/dev/docker-compose.local.database.yml

+3-3
Original file line numberDiff line numberDiff line change
@@ -3,11 +3,11 @@ version: "3"
33
services:
44
database:
55
build:
6-
context: ../database
6+
context: ../../database
77
dockerfile: Dockerfile
88
volumes:
9-
- ../database/data:/var/lib/mysql
10-
- ../database/mysql/conf/my.cnf:/etc/mysql/conf.d/my.cnf
9+
- ../../database/data:/var/lib/mysql
10+
- ../../database/mysql/conf/my.cnf:/etc/mysql/conf.d/my.cnf
1111
ports:
1212
- 3306:3306
1313
environment:

server/docker/docker-compose.local.server.yml server/docker/dev/docker-compose.local.server.yml

+2-2
Original file line numberDiff line numberDiff line change
@@ -3,12 +3,12 @@ version: "3"
33
services:
44
server:
55
build:
6-
context: ../
6+
context: ../../
77
dockerfile: Dockerfile
88
ports:
99
- 8080:8080
1010
volumes:
11-
- ../:/go/src/github.com/Doer-org/glyph
11+
- ../../:/go/src/github.com/Doer-org/glyph
1212
environment:
1313
- ENVIRONMENT=${ENVIRONMENT}
1414
- WEBHOOKURL=${WEBHOOKURL}

0 commit comments

Comments
 (0)